Accreditation

The Office of Continuing Education and Professional Development (CEPD), Faculty of Medicine, University of Toronto is fully accredited by the Committee on Accreditation of Continuing Medical Education (CACME), a subcommittee of the Committee on Accreditation of Canadian Medical Schools (CACMS). This standard allows the Office of CEPD to assign credits for educational activities based on the criteria established by The College of Family Physicians of Canada, the Royal College of Physicians and Surgeons of Canada, the American Medical Association, and the European Accreditation Council for Continuing Medical Education (EACCME).

Assigned Credits

Royal College of Physicians and Surgeons of Canada

This event is an Accredited Group Learning Activity (Section 1) as defined by the Maintenance of Certification program of the Royal College of Physicians and Surgeons of Canada, approved by the University of Toronto (20 credits).

American Medical Association

The Office of Continuing Education and Professional Development, Faculty of Medicine, University of Toronto, designates this educational activity for a maximum of 20 category 1 credits toward the AMA Physician’s Recognition Award. Each physician should claim only those credits that he/she actually spent in the activity.

The College of Family Physicians of Canada

This program meets the accreditation criteria of The College of Family Physicians of Canada and has been accredited for up to 20 Mainpro-M1 credits.
